Allow confirming a choice while navigating the context menu for nested entries #1967

Navigation of the context menu of an operator with the keyboard arrow keys is very intuitive. However, there seems to be currently no way to "lock" or confirm a selection for nested entries (like Strings or Lists) since "Enter" seems to have the same effect as "Right" by going down the hierarchy of the menu.

With the goal to afford a keyboard-only coding experiment in the editor, I think it should be possible to use the "Enter" key to confirm ANY selection (if available). It should be noted that the context menu can already be opened from any operator with the standard Windows shortcut (Shift+F10).

To reproduce:

image

Attempt to use keyboard only to member select Item1
